SAAM launches with proclamation signing ceremony on April 2

(NMCADSV) — The Northern Marianas Coalition Against Domestic & Sexual Violence and its community partners invite the public to the Sexual Assault Awareness Month or SAAM proclamation signing ceremony on Wednesday, April 2, 2025, at 10 a.m. at the Royal Taga Ballroom, Saipan World Resort in Susupe. This ceremony will officially declare    April    as    Sexual    Assault    Awareness    Month    across    the    CNMI.

Led by NMCADSV staff and the 2025 SAAM Planning Committee, the ceremony will feature a keynote speaker. For those unable to attend in person, the program will be livestreamed in partnership with Marianas Press and can be viewed on NMCADSV’s Facebook page: https://www.facebook.com/EndViolenceNMI/.

On Sunday, April 6, 2025, at 9 a.m., NMCADSV will observe a Day of Prayer at San Roque Parish. Faith-based organizations have also been invited to share messages of advocacy against sexual violence during their services or Eucharistic celebrations.

Mark your calendars for Wednesday, April 30, 2025, and join the movement for National Denim Day with the Wave, Walk, and Roll Against Sexual Violence. The event will begin at the Kagman Community Center, with registration opening at 4:30 p.m. Participants are encouraged to wear denim, bring posters, and take part in a roadside waving. The event will conclude with a one-mile walk through the village, promoting solidarity and awareness in the effort to end sexual violence.

Throughout April, the Coalition will also host a series of radio shows on KKMP 92.1 FM every Wednesday at 8 a.m. These discussions, featuring NMCADSV staff, committee members, and local partner agencies, will cover key topics related to sexual assault awareness and education, providing the community with valuable insights and resources.

In addition to these broadcasts, NMCADSV is excited to announce a series of in-person SAAM events across the neighboring islands of Tinian and Rota. On Tinian, a Roadside Painting and Walk will take place on Friday, April 11, followed by a Softball Tournament from April 12–13, 2025. Meanwhile, on Rota, in partnership with DCCA-Division of Youth Services, events will include the SAAM/CAN Handwave Outreach on April 4, the Project PROM Workshop on April 25, and the “Safe@Home” Family Fun Day & Softball Tournament on April 26, 2025.
